In my series of paintings on ponds, lakes, lagoons, and other bodies of water, I explore the essence of life's origins and our profound interconnectedness with the earth. Each canvas portrays not just a body of water, but a universe brimming with life, stories, and reflections of our shared existence. At the heart of my work is the rich, life-giving substrate that lies at the bottom of these water bodies. This fertile combination of soil, sediment, and organic matter is like a womb, nurturing the beginnings of life. It supports the tiniest organisms, which in turn sustain larger forms of life, creating a delicate and intricate web of existence. Through my brushstrokes, I aim to bring this unseen, yet vital, world to the forefront, celebrating the foundation of life that sustains us all.
In this series, I blend my observations and reflections with a deep appreciation for the natural world. By bringing the life within bodies of water, including ponds, to my canvas, I aim to highlight the interconnectedness of all life forms and the profound importance of our relationship with the earth. Through rich, textured depictions of the fertile substrate, likened to a womb, and the shimmering play of light, I invite viewers to embark on a journey of discovery and introspection, celebrating the wonders of life’s beginnings and our place within the natural world.
